May 25: The 200 Club’s
7th Annual Savannah Mile Run
Beginning in Forsyth Park and continuing one mile down Drayton Street, and then finishing up on Broughton Street, the 7th annual Savannah Mile Run attracts all levels of runners from children to experts on Saturday, May 25 at 8 a.m. This annual run is put on by The 200 Club of the Coastal Empire, a nonprofit providing immediate financial assistance to families of public safety officials who lost their lives in the line of duty.

Adventures of the Coast Guard
“In the event that the helicopter goes down, just remember R.E.I.R.S.E.L,” says Cory Ceikot, a rescue swimmer with the United States Coast Guard Air Station Savannah. “’R’ is for reference point, ‘E’ is for emergency exit …” he says, explaining the safety procedure used for water crashes. They are not words I want to hear. But it’s too late. Suddenly, I’m upside down, under water, caged in on all sides, and scrambling to release the seatbelt buckle that will free me and allow me to surface. I can’t get the belt undone. What have I gotten myself into?”

The Wildest Jobs in the South
“When people find out what I do the two inevitable responses are: ‘You couldn’t pay me a million dollars to do that.’ Or, ‘That’s so cool!’ But it’s much more typical to hear the, ‘You couldn’t pay me enough’ response,” says Brady King. King is a professional rope-access widow washer who sometimes spends up to eight hours a day dangling above the city with a suction cup in one hand and squeegee in the other.
But that statement could have belonged to any of the professionals we interviewed to find out more about the South’s most adventurous, dangerous and killer jobs. Because whether they are seven stories above the ground or 70 feet below sea level, let’s face it, the competition is going to be pretty slim. For this issue, we talked with scuba divers who brave the Southern swamps to find fossils from millions of years ago and guys that scale 90-foot pine trees. High Speed Action comes to Macon, Georgia
Macon’s reputation as a film location is growing with the addition of this exciting project. This spring, Macon, GA, will play a key role as a location to the upcoming action movie “Need for Speed.” Based on the popular video games, this film will be fraught with high-octane thrills and racing action. Director Scott Waugh, who also directed 2012’s “Act of Valor,” will be working on this DreamWorks Studios film. The movie will star Aaron Paul, Dominic Cooper, Imogen Poots and Michael Keaton.

Gulfstream’s Live Well. Be Well.
Presents Suze Orman
Suze Orman received a standing ovation before she even took the stage at the Savannah International Trade and Convention Center on Saturday as part of Gulfstream’s Live Well. Be Well. lecture series. The packed audience, made up of Gulfstream staffers and members of the Savannah community, was on its feet as one of America’s most influential and beloved financial advisors was introduced by Gulfstream’s CFO, Jason Aiken. In true rock star fashion, Orman stepped out front and center, foregoing the podium, clad in all-black and high heeled boots, and flashed her megawatt grin and trademark short blonde ‘do. Her charisma, sincerity and smarts were just as palpable in this crowded venue as they are when she speaks directly to the camera every Saturday night on The Suze Orman Show.

Video: Banff Mountain Film Festival in Savannah
Need your outdoors fix? Join South and Half-Moon Outfitters at the Trustees Theater this Sunday at 6:30 p.m. for the Banff Mountain Film Festival. The Banff Mountain Film Festival World Tour is stopping in Savannah for one night only to highlight a collection of inspiring action, environmental and adventure films from the festival, which takes place in Banff, Alberta, every year. Fly to other countries, scale mountains, get close-up with wild life, step onto a highline and gear up for some hardcore action sports.

This Saturday, Gulfstream Presents Suze Orman
Gulfstream’s Live Well. Be Well. lecture series continues this Saturday at 9:30 a.m. at the Savannah International Trade and Convention Center with speaker Suze Orman. One of the country’s foremost financial experts, New York Times bestselling author and two-time Emmy Award winning host of The Suze Orman Show, Orman’s practical, common sense approach to money management has helped countless Americans take charge of their finances.
Orman was recently named one of Forbes Top 10 Most Influential Celebrities, due in no small part to her skill as a public speaker and effective communicator. She has lectured on personal finance all over the world.
As part of Gulfstream’s Live Well. Be Well. series, Orman will engage in a question and answer period moderated by speaker and author Lisa Oz. Tickets are $10 for general admission and $30 for VIP seating.
